Monthly UV Index in Jeffrey's Bay

Average daily maximum UV index by month

Jan
10
Feb
10
Mar
9
Apr
8
May
7
Jun
6
Jul
6
Aug
6
Sep
7
Oct
8
Nov
9
Dec
10

When is the peak UV time in Jeffrey's Bay?
UV levels in Jeffrey's Bay typically peak between 11:00 AM and 2:00 PM local time. The exact peak depends on the season, cloud cover, and altitude.
